Error Code dC1
The dishwasher door isn't fully closed
Minor
Usually easy to fix - may resolve on its own
Also displayed as: dC (dC1)
What This Means
Door not fully closed or latched; Door lock switch is defective; Door sensing switch connector is loose
What actually causes this:
The door wasn't pushed closed firmly enough, or something is blocking it from latching
First Thing to Check
Push the door firmly until you hear it click shut — check that no dish handles or utensils are sticking out

How to Fix
- 1
1. Check the connections for the door sensing switch — check the white wire and connected switch. Normal: 10.5 to 13V when door is open, less than 1V when door is closed
- 2
2. Check the operation of the door sensing switch (remove connector before measuring) — check the blue wire and connected switch. Normal: SHORT when door is open, OPEN when door is closed
- 3
3. If switch tests faulty, replace the door sensing switch
- 4
4. Check the operation of the Power Relay — if normal, replace Main PBA
